"Cemmento does the following:

  1. When a URL is passed, it checks whether a version exists in the storage backend (in this case, the Internet Archive) with the querystring ?cemmento.
  2. If a version does not exist, Cemmento requests the internet archive to store a copy.
  3. Cemmento redirects the user to the earliest copy on the internet archive, using a Via service to automatically load a commenting/annotation engine (in this case, Hypothesis)."
